About the role

  • The Senior Contract Specialist position is responsible for drafting, reviewing, negotiating, and administration of a broad range of tenders, proposals, and other commercial contracts.
  • Individual will be further aligned to counsel internal department on the legal, regulatory, and business obligations set forth within contracts and elevate any issues to associate and/or general counsel as appropriate.
  • Oversee the contract process, end to end, from drafting complex commercial agreements to managing the negotiation process and understanding the key regulatory and industry trends, to monitoring and reporting contract compliance for all business units.

Responsibilities

  • Effectively manage the contract management system and ensure on-time processing of all contracts from initial request through execution.
  • Lead efforts to update and maintain the legal terms and conditions held with the contract management system.
  • Proactively manages communications and follow-up with the stakeholders to ensure best customer service and visibility of the end to end contract processes
